16 days of Action against Domestic Violence

25th November - 10th December - 16 Days of Action Against Domestic Violence is aimed at businesses to support them to take action against domestic abuse and violence.  Employers have a legal obligation to assess dynamic risk and support the health and safety and wellness of their employees. Companies can do more to aid their employees who endure domestic violence, to train those who witness it, and to protect staff as a whole, with the goal of securing safety and mitigating financial loss. Spanning across 16 days from 25th November to 10th December, a theme will be identified each day to explore the various forms of domestic violence. In doing so, the workplace will be better equipped to acknowledge the signs that indicate it may be going on.  Please make a corporate pledge to tackle domestic violence and to sign up to the campaign.

Self Care Week 2021

  • Self Care Week is an annual UK-wide national awareness week that focuses on embedding support for self care across communities, families and generations.
  • Practise Self Care for Life is the theme for 2021
  • The Self Care Forum has been organising Self Care Week since 2011

Upcoming Campaigns
Download our Wellbeing at Work Events Calendar here and use it for planning your healthy lifestyle events.
 
1st - 30th November - Movember - The annual campaign is back, supporting men's mental health, suicide prevent, prostate and testicular cancer. For more information, click here

15th - 22nd November - Alcohol Awareness Week 2021 - This years theme is Alcohol and Relationships, raising awareness of what can change can be caused by alcohol. For more information, click here.

19th November - International Men's Day 2021 - An annual campaign to celebrate what value men bring to their families and communities. The Campaign highlights the importance of wellbeing and how it can support men. For more information, click here.

22nd November - 22nd December 2021 - Disability History Month 2021 - A month of activity to raise awareness and support people with disabilities. For more information, click here.


25th November - 10th December 2021 - 16 days of Action Against Domestic Violence - A campaign to raise awareness about Domestic Violence. Organisations to make a pledge in support of this cause. For more information, click here.

1st - 7th December 2021 - National Handwashing Awareness Week - A campaign that raises awareness of the importance of washing your hands, click here.
